Silverhill is a community in Baldwin County, Alabama, home to 929 residents. The median household income of $61,081 is below the Baldwin County median ($75,019).

Between 2019 and 2023, Silverhill's population grew 44.0% from 645 to 929, while its median home value rose 35.7% from $191,900 to $260,500.

97.8% of homes are single-family detached houses. The typical home was built around 1994.
